Have a Biostar TA790GX 128M coming, it has Radeon HD3300 graphics. How might this stack up against my current (old, but not integrated) 7900GS card?

I cant imagine any situation where the HD3300 could beat the 7900gs. in older games the 7900gs would easily beat the crap out of that 3300 integrated gpu. considering that the hd3300 has less than half the power of 2600xt or 8600gt then I dont see it beating the 7900gs in newer games either.

yeah the 3300 has 40 shaders while the 2600xt has 120 shaders. the 2600xt and 8600gt are about even in games so yeah a 3300 would have less than half the power of a 2600xt or 8600gt. the 3300 is almost identical to a 2400xt so this should give you an idea. http://www.gamespot.com/features/6182806/p-5.html

For general HD video playback, desktop usage, and power/noise concerns, the HD3300 is the clear winner. For gaming, the 7900 wins hands down. Though if you're gaming, even a cheap 4830 or 4670, or 9600GT, will stomp the guts out of a 7900, and is pretty much required for a decent experience in most games from 2008+ at common resolutions like 1440x900, 1680x1050, or especially anything above that.

Well, the results are in.

X2-3800 @ 2.4GHz, 7900GS - 4200 3DMarks
X3-710 @ 2.6GHz, integrated HD 3300 - 1897 3DMarks

I really need a new video card.
